Step 1.2: Analyze Traffic Loss

In Google Analytics/Search Console:

  1. Compare pre-update vs post-update traffic
  2. Identify which pages lost traffic
  3. Note which queries dropped
Traffic Analysis Checklist:
□ Date of traffic drop matches update rollout?
□ Which pages lost most traffic?
□ Which keywords dropped?
□ Site-wide or section-specific?
□ Mobile vs Desktop differences?

Step 1.3: Pattern Recognition

PatternLikely Cause
All pages droppedDomain-level issue
Specific section droppedCategory/topic issue
Money pages droppedQuality/commercial intent issue
Info pages fine, reviews droppedProduct review update
New content ranks, old doesn'tContent freshness issue

Emergency Checklist

If severely hit (90%+ traffic loss):

Immediate Actions:
□ Check for manual action in GSC
□ Verify no security issues
□ Check robots.txt not blocking
□ Verify canonical tags correct
□ Check for massive de-indexation
